I've only had my "D5-300 Thunderbolt 3" for a few days. I had no problem setting up the RAID 5 system with 5 x 8TB SSD drives. However, as soon as my Mac goes into sleep mode the drive seems to fail (after about 30 seconds) and the alarm goes off. As you can see from the attachment from the RAID Manager Pro, it mentions channel 1, 2 or 3 failing. And now it seems to be rebuilding. I see from other customer complaints (on Amazon) that this problem when sleeping iMacs has happened to other people. Is there anyway of solving this problem? I'm running Big Sur on a 2017 iMac.
